begin process at 2010 02 10 01:23:41
  Trouver un code source :
 
dans
 
Accueil > Forum > 

Archive C#

 > 

Archives

 > 

.NET

 > 

C# - remplir textbox avec requete sql


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

C# - remplir textbox avec requete sql

mercredi 4 mai 2005 à 17:53:54 | C# - remplir textbox avec requete sql

eowene

Bonjour à tous.
Je suis débutante en C# et je dois avouer que j'ai pas mal de soucis pour faire des petite choses. Je travaille sur Pocket PC.
Bref, là, j'ai une table client(nom,prenom,tel,mail)
Je rempli une combobox(list_client) avec une requete SQL qui va chercher le nom des clients (pour le moment ma combo contient DUPONT, MARTIN,...)
Je voudrais qu'en selectionnant un nom dans la liste, ça remplisse les champs texte de ma page.
Pour le moment, j'ai fais un ça :

SqlCeDataReader reader = null;
SqlCeConnection connection = null;
SqlCeCommand command = null;
Object[] row = null;
// Chaîne de connexion
connection = new SqlCeConnection(@"Data Source=\My Documents\maBase.sdf");
// Objet Command
command = new SqlCeCommand("SELECT * FROM CLIENT WHERE nom = '"+list_client.SelectedItem+"'", connection);
connection.Open();
reader = command.ExecuteReader();
row = new Object[reader.FieldCount];
reader.GetValues(row);
TB_client.Text = row.GetValue(2).ToString();
// Fermeture reader
reader.Close();
// Fermeture connection
connection.Close(); 
 
Mais ça ne fonctionne pas. J'ai une erreur au niveau de la ligne :
TB_client.Text = row.GetValue(2).ToString(); 

Voici mon erreur :
No data exists for the row/column 

Est ce que quelqu'un pourrait m'aider à comprendre comment ça fonctionne. Merci d'avance.

mercredi 4 mai 2005 à 18:54:44 | Re : C# - remplir textbox avec requete sql

Arthenius

Membre Club
A la place de
row = new Object[reader.FieldCount];
reader.GetValues(row);
TB_client.Text = row.GetValue(2).ToString();


je ferais un
while (reader.read())
{
tb_client.Text = reader.Getstring(2);
}

kkchose comme cela...
pit etre...

Arthenius
http://blogs.developpeur.org/Arthenius/

"Ce qui ne me tue pas, me rend plus fort..."

vendredi 6 mai 2005 à 11:34:40 | Re : C# - remplir textbox avec requete sql

eowene

J'ai essayé de mettre TB_client.Text = "ABCD"; pour tester et ça ne fonctionne pas nom plus, ça me donne la même erreur mais je ne sais pas d'où ça peut venir...


Cette discussion est classée dans : connection, client, row, command, reader


Répondre à ce message

Sujets en rapport avec ce message

Problème de requête paramétrée [ par loic20h28 ] Bonjour tout le monde, Je souhaite réaliser une requête paramétrée.J'ai réalisé quelque chose mais malheureusement cela ne fonctionne pas.EXPLICATION la requette d'insertion [ par Marakima ] Bonsoir tous le monde , Je suis débutante en C#, alors je réalise une application en C# et MySql,j'ai effectuer la requette de selection dont voiçi le sql null exception [ par verbeyst ] La méthode suivante me renvoie une erreur quand je tente de l'exécuter sur immediate windowvoici le message erreur : "Data is null, this methode canno Accès aux données en utilisant des objets [ par shadow1779 ] Bonjour, Cela fais un petit moment que j'essaye de me mettre au C#, j'essaye d'aborder l'accès aux données avec ADO.Net, dans un premier temps sur un sql server 2008 [ par djbabou ] Bonjour a tous [^^happy13] Je vous expose mon probleme en espérant que vous pourrez m'aider. Je développe une application tournant en client/serveur Select INTO avec variables [ par SaiYan5102 ] Bonjour, Je désire récupérer la valeur de certains champs se trouvant dans une table d'une base de donnée SQL server. Ces valeurs j souhaites les sto probleme code requête parametrée [ par zakaroh ] bonjour, je veux réalisé une requete parametrée j'ai ecris le code suivant : private void button1_Click(object sender, EventArgs e) { créer un DataGrid une ligne une colonne! [ par sayuiki ] Salut, Je suis tout nouveau dans le c# et aussi ds ce forum! Voilà je veux créer simplement un DataGrid d'une ligne une colonne de telle sorte que la probs requête sql avec paramètres [ par patou1007 ] bonjour,je suis vraiment frustré car je n'arrive pas à faire une requête sql avec paramètres :voiçi une partie de mon code: public <FONT color=# Requête parametré et myssql [ par aquibad ] Bonjour à tous,Mon pb est le suivant : J'essai de faire une composant d'accés aux base de données.Toutes les commandes passent bien (connection, comma


Nos sponsors


Sondage...

CalendriCode

Février 2010
LMMJVSD
1234567
891011121314
15161718192021
22232425262728

Consulter la suite du CalendriCode

 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,218 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ales